Srinagar, Dec 15 (KNO): Flight cancellations at Srinagar Airport by IndiGo have largely normalised, airport officials said on Monday, noting that the airline is gradually resuming operations after earlier disruptions.
An official from Srinagar International Airport told the news agency—Kashmir News Observer (KNO) that of the 64 scheduled flights for the day, including 32 arrivals and 32 departures. Among them, 36 were operated by IndiGo, he said.
He added that operational and weather-related issues led to 4 IndiGo flights cancellations due to operational reasons and 4 cancellations due to bad weather, along with 18 delayed IndiGo flights caused by adverse weather conditions.
"Other airlines, including Air India, Akasa Air and SpiceJet, reported 6 cancellations, with 10 delays affecting flights in total," the official said. "We continue to monitor conditions. The passengers must check with their respective airlines before travelling."—(KNO)
